InterOPERA crossed the Atlantic to take part in the International Conference on Power Systems Transients (IPST) 2025, held in Guadalajara, Mexico.
Representing the project, Réseau de Transport d’Électricité (RTE) delivered a presentation covering InterOPERA’s objectives and the analysis of system interactions within multi-terminal HVDC grids. The presentation provided insights into how ElectroMagnetic Transients (EMT) simulations support the design and stability of interconnected HVDC systems – crucial for the success of InterOPERA’s technical demonstrators.
Later in the week, the project was further highlighted through the presentation of a new scientific paper: “Design of Bipolar MT HVDC Grids: Contingency Analysis and Preliminary Dynamic Studies”. Co-authored by C. Cardozo, H. Clémot, B. De Foucaud, J. Pouget, P. Rault, S. Dennetière, T. Qoria, and S. Hansen, the paper outlines a structured design study methodology aimed at characterising subsystem stresses and supporting the definition of technical specifications for the InterOPERA demonstrator
